Dynamiq’s Jetsetter is a name to remember, as this incredible superyacht project has already raised the bar to the next level in the world of semi-custom vessels. We’ve already mentioned this gorgeous 39-meter yacht on Luxatic, a vessel that benefits from some of the industry’s top players, which joined forces to create the perfect yacht.

Luxury, comfort, functionality, and autonomy – this covers everything the future owners of this beauty will be enjoying aboard this vessel. Jetsetter will prove to be an incredible package, showing off nothing but state of the art building techniques and technologies.

The modern GT vessel features a shallow draft of just 1.75 meters, allowing it to cruise the Bahamas without a care, and since it offers a range of 3,000 nm, probably no destination will be too far away.

Jetsetter

The designers from Azure Yachts and Van Oossanen Naval Architects developed the fast displacement hull before you, aiming for supreme comfort – thanks to the electrically driven CMC stabilizers – while the yacht is able to reach an impressive top speed of 21 knots.

Dynamiq will allow potential customers to customize virtually any element of their future yacht, from technical equipment to interior fittings. Top brands such as Hermès, Loro Piana and Trussardi could be adding their touch in order to enhance the premium feel of this stunning yacht, which must be a lavish home away from home as it takes its passengers from one corner of the world to another.

All guest accommodations can be found on the lower deck, leaving the main deck open for entertaining, crew operations, and navigation. Are you ready for a cruise?
